How Positive Affirmations Shape a Child’s Confidence and Mindset

Every parent dreams of raising children who are confident, resilient, and ready to face life’s challenges. One subtle yet powerful way to nurture these qualities is through positive affirmations. These are simple, encouraging statements that, when repeated consistently, help children internalize a sense of self-worth and optimism. Whether spoken in the morning routine, during play, or before bedtime, positive affirmations can profoundly shape a child’s mindset.

Encouraging Confidence Through Words

Positive affirmations are more than just nice words; they are tools that shape the way children perceive themselves. Imagine a child attempting to solve a puzzle for the first time. If they hear encouraging statements such as, “You can do this,” or “Mistakes help us learn,” they are more likely to approach the task with curiosity and determination. Over time, these small moments accumulate, teaching children that setbacks are not failures but opportunities to improve.

Fostering a Growth Mindset

Beyond confidence, positive affirmations help children cultivate a growth mindset. When children are reminded that effort, practice, and persistence are valuable, they develop resilience and a willingness to embrace new challenges. For example, a simple statement like, “I can learn anything I try,” reinforces the idea that intelligence and talent are not fixed but can grow with effort.

Parents and teachers can create a consistent affirmation routine to support this mindset. Morning affirmations, visual reminders in the play area, or storytelling that highlights characters overcoming obstacles can all reinforce positive thinking. By integrating affirmations into both home and school life, children receive consistent reinforcement of their self-worth and potential.

Building Emotional Intelligence

Positive affirmations also enhance emotional intelligence. Children who regularly engage in affirmations are better equipped to recognize and express their feelings, empathize with others, and handle social interactions constructively. Saying statements like, “I am kind to my friends,” or “I respect others’ feelings,” teaches children the value of empathy and social awareness from a young age. This early foundation is critical for developing strong interpersonal skills that benefit them throughout life.

Making Affirmations a Daily Habit

To make affirmations truly effective, consistency is key. A child’s mind is impressionable, and repeated exposure to positive language strengthens neural pathways that support confidence and self-belief. Caregivers can make this practice fun and interactive, turning it into a game or incorporating it into creative activities such as drawing, role-play, or storytelling.
